首页 - 车源信息 > 货运jsq

货运jsq

发布于:2024-08-13 作者:dengyantao 阅读:79
"货运JSQ是中国领先的快递物流公司,成立于2008年。公司的主要业务是物流配送、供应链管理以及国际快递等。JSQ以其专业的服务质量和优秀的客户服务而受到客户的广泛好评。其服务网络遍布全国,覆盖190多个大中城市,并通过现代化的信息技术手段,为客户提供方便快捷的服务。JSQ还积极参与公益活动,致力于社会的发展和进步。"

基于Node.js的实时货物追踪系统设计与实现

在当前物流行业,物流追踪系统的运行和优化已经成为了提升企业竞争力的重要环节,而使用JavaScript进行开发的实时货物追踪系统,则为这一目标提供了有力的支持。

我们要明确一点,就是如何在JavaScript中实现实时货物追踪系统,这主要涉及到两个方面:一是前端逻辑处理,二是后端数据处理。

货运jsq

从前端逻辑处理的角度来看,我们需要构建一个实时数据交换平台,这个平台可以接受货物信息(如货物数量、货物状态等),并将其发送到后端进行处理,对于每一条货物信息,我们都需要在其基础上添加一些额外的信息,例如货物的位置信息、运输过程中的时间戳等。

在编写这部分代码时,我们可以利用Node.js的EventEmitter模块来实现,EventEmitter是Node.js内置的一个事件处理器模块,可以用来创建、发布和订阅事件,在这个例子中,我们可以通过emit方法来触发一个货物增加或减少的消息,然后通过on方法来监听这个消息,从而获取到货物的状态。

从后端数据处理的角度来看,我们需要构建一个货物跟踪数据库,这个数据库应该能够存储货物的所有相关信息,包括货物的数量、货物的状态、运输过程中的时间戳等,我们还需要设置一些规则,例如当货物到达目的地或者在途中出现故障时,需要通知相应的服务器。

货运jsq

在编写这部分代码时,我们可以利用Node.js的MySQL库来建立数据库,MySQL是一个开源的关系型数据库管理系统,它可以用来存储和管理各种类型的数据,在这里,我们可以创建一个名为"货物追踪"的表,其中包含货物的数量、货物的状态、运输过程中的时间戳等字段。

我们需要将前端和后端的数据整合起来,以便实现实时货物追踪功能,这可能涉及到一些复杂的API调用,但是只要掌握了Node.js的基本语法和HTTP协议,就可以很容易地实现这一点。

通过结合JavaScript的特性,我们可以构建出一个功能强大、性能高效的实时货物追踪系统,这只是个初步的设计,实际的应用中还可能会遇到许多问题,例如性能瓶颈、数据一致性等问题,我们在实际应用中,还需要不断地进行优化和改进。

货运jsq

二维码

扫一扫关注我们

版权声明: 本文内容由互联网用户自发贡献,本站不拥有所有权,不承担相关法律责任。如果发现本站有涉嫌抄袭的内容,欢迎发送邮件至 324770653@qq.com举报,并提供相关证据,一经查实,本站将立刻删除涉嫌侵权内容。

相关文章

货运专线

电话咨询
大件运输